Our client are recruiting for 2 Print Finishers / Guillotine Operators at the impressive production facility in East London. The Finisher will produce accurate work to specification within a fast-paced print production environment. Utilising industrial print finishing machinery to ensure finished products meet quality standards, production schedules and safety requirements.
Key Responsibilities
- Operate programmable and manual guillotine cutting, safely and efficiently.
- Read and interpret job sheets accurately, to maintain integrity of the finished product.
- Be able to set guillotine programs.
- Inspect printed products for quality, alignment and trimming accuracy.
- Competent in guillotine blade changes (training for this can be provided).
- Perform routine maintenance and blade checks.
Skills & Qualifications
- Experience operating industrial print finishing guillotines.
- Good numerical and measuring skills.
- Ability to read production specifications and job instructions.
- Strong attention to detail and accuracy.
- Strong awareness of health & safety policies.
- Ability to work under pressure to meet deadlines.
- Good teamwork and communication skills.
Desirable
- Experience with Polar, Perfecta or Wohlenberg guillotines.
- Understanding of other Lamination, Stitching, Folding and Book Binding finishing processes.
- Forklift License.
- Experience with Siteflow MIS systems.
Physical Requirements
Role involves a level of manual handling; a good standard of physical fitness is required.
Flexibility
Primarily night shift, with flexibility required to support business needs. Willingness to work additional hours during peak periods or to cover absence.
Two positions available: Sunday - Wednesday night shift or Monday - Thursday night shift. Both are 20:00 - 06:00.
